This morning I took apart the new bindist for 941222-SNAP and tried to upgrade my system by hand. I must have missed something because routed now complains "protocol not supported" whenever I try to add a route. When I boot the 2.0R kernel the problem goes away. Is this something that I forgot to copy correctly from the new bindist or is the 941222-SNAP kernel at fault? Any ideas welcome.
